Have you ever woken up after riding a rollercoaster in your dream and wondered what it meant? Rollercoaster dream meaning is one of the most searched dream topics because these dreams often reflect life’s emotional highs and lows, unexpected changes, and personal challenges.
If the ride felt exciting, terrifying, or completely out of control, your subconscious may be trying to communicate something important. A rollercoaster represents movement, uncertainty, excitement, fear, and transformation. The exact meaning depends on your emotions, the condition of the ride, and what happened during the dream.
Dream analysts generally agree that rollercoaster dreams symbolize periods of instability, emotional growth, major life decisions, and learning to trust the journey. Let’s explore every possible interpretation.

What is the general rollercoaster dream meaning?
A rollercoaster dream usually symbolizes emotional ups and downs, unexpected life changes, personal growth, and learning to adapt to uncertainty.
Is dreaming about rollercoasters a good sign?
Yes. If the ride feels exciting or enjoyable, it often represents confidence, adventure, success, and embracing new opportunities.
Why was I scared during the rollercoaster dream?
Fear often reflects anxiety, stress, uncertainty, or concerns about losing control in waking life.
What does a broken rollercoaster mean in dreams?
It commonly symbolizes obstacles, delays, emotional struggles, or plans that require adjustment before moving forward.
What does riding a rollercoaster with someone mean?
It may represent a shared emotional journey, relationship challenges, mutual support, or experiencing life changes together.
What is the biblical meaning of a rollercoaster dream?
Biblically, it can symbolize trusting God during life’s changing seasons, remaining faithful through challenges, and growing spiritually.
Does a rollercoaster dream predict the future?
Dreams generally reflect your thoughts, emotions, and subconscious experiences rather than predicting future events.
Why do I keep dreaming about rollercoasters?
Recurring rollercoaster dreams often indicate ongoing stress, repeated emotional cycles, unresolved fears, or significant life transitions that deserve attention.
